Key features

Up to five handsets work from one base

You can make internal calls between handsets, transfer

an external caller to another handset and hold three way calls between two handsets and an external caller.

Excellent handset range

Under ideal conditions you

can use your Synergy 2110 handset at up to 300 metres from the base station outside, or up to

50 metres inside.

KEY FEATURES

10 number memory

Store up to 10 of your most important or frequently

dialled numbers in the memory. It’s then easy to display and dial numbers in the memory. Each Synergy 2110 handset has an individual memory.

Enhanced call clarity

Highly advanced digital technology (DECT)

ensures much clearer calls than the older style phones.

Earpiece volume control

You can adjust the volume of the handset receiver during a call to low, medium or high.

Last number redial

Display and redial the last number called from your handset.

Caller Display & Calls List

Lets you know who’s calling you before answering the telephone, allowing you to decide whether or not to answer the call.

Also saves the details of the last 10 callers in a Calls List.
